A Stir in the Entertainment Industry
Filmmaker Karan Johar’s Concern
Karan Johar’s recent expression of dismay regarding comedian Kettan Singh’s mimicry act in a promo of “Madness Machayenge: Duniya Ko Hasayenge” has sparked controversy and raised questions about the boundaries of humor.
The Frenzy Among the Cast
Karan Johar’s critique has led to a frenzy among the cast members, highlighting the impact of his words and the sensitivity surrounding comedic performances.
Paritosh Tripathi Speaks Out
Defending His Co-Star
Comedian Paritosh Tripathi, co-star of Kettan Singh, has stepped forward to defend his colleague against the backlash, emphasizing the mutual respect they hold for Karan Johar.
The Intent Behind Comedy
In an exclusive interview, Paritosh sheds light on the true intentions of the comedians involved in the show, emphasizing that their primary goal is to evoke laughter without causing offense or harm.
Ensuring Laughter Without Hurt
Paritosh emphasizes that the comedians on the show are committed to using their comic skills to spread joy and entertainment, reassuring audiences that their acts are not intended to hurt or offend anyone.
